Clothing and fashion
do up
E If you do something up, you fasten it.
She showed her son how to do up his shoes.
I can't do my top button up.
Hi If a piece of clothing does up in a particular place, it is fastened there.
The top does up at the back.
S If a woman does her hair up, she arranges it so that it is fastened close to her head rather than hanging loosely. 
She did her hair up in a pony tail.
Her hair was done up in a neat bun at the back of her head.
dress up
El 
If you dress up or dress someone up, you put special, smart clothes on yourself or someone else, usually 
for a social occasion.
It's fun to dress up for a party.
I like to dress my little girl up in pretty clothes.
H] If you dress up or dress someone up, you put special costumes or unusual clothes on yourself or someone 
else, usually for fun, often at a party where everyone does this.
Maisie loves to dress up in her Grandma's clothes. 
l/l/e dressed Alex up as Superman for Amelia's party.
get on
If you get a piece of clothing on, you dress yourself in it.
Get your coat on.
1 NOTE I You can also use put on.
go with
If one thing goes with another, they suit each other or are pleasant or attractive together.
Those shoes go with your dress.
have on
If you have clothing on, you are wearing it.
I can't wait to take these shoes o ff- I've had them on all day.
She had on an old jacket.
pick out
If you pick out one thing, you choose it from a group.
Christina picked out a nice pair of shoes to wear.
She picked a skirt out that she thought Ellie would like.
pull off
When you pull a piece of clothing off or pull a piece of clothing off someone else, you take it off quickly.
I managed to pull my boots off.
James pulled off his socks.
I pulled Tom's boots off his feet.
